/*
 * @author Mr Liu
 * sql语句的连接基本步骤:
 *    1、驱动程序名  
 *    2、URL指向要访问的数据库名Database 
 *    3、 MySQL配置时的用户名
 *    4、MySQL配置时的密码  
 *    5、加载驱动程序    
 *    6、连续数据库  
 *    7、statement用来执行SQL语句   
 *    8、要执行的SQL语句
 *    9、结果集
 *    10、选择需要显示的这列数据
 *    11、输出结果
 *                       
 */
public class SqlConnection {

/**
     * @param args
     * @throws Exception
     */
    public static void main(String[] args) throws Exception {
        // 驱动程序名  
        String driver = "com.mysql.jdbc.Driver";
        // URL指向要访问的数据库名Database
        String url = "jdbc:mysql://127.0.0.1:3306/Liuzhi";
        // MySQL配置时的用户名
        String username = "root";
        // MySQL配置时的密码 
        String password = "root";
        // 加载驱动程序    
        Class.forName(driver);
        // 连续数据库 
        Connection conn = DriverManager.getConnection(url, username, password);
        if (!conn.isClosed()) {
            System.out.println("Succeeded connecting to the Database!");
            // statement用来执行SQL语句           
            Statement statement = conn.createStatement();
        //要执行的SQL语句
            String sql="select id,xm,username,passw from student";
        //结果集    
            ResultSet result=statement.executeQuery(sql);
            while(result.next()){
                System.out.println(result.getString("xm"));
            }
            
        }
    }

}

我的数据库:

输出结果:

JAVA简单连接数据库(Mysql)相关推荐

  1. preparestatement方法用多次_如何用java 5分钟实现一个最简单的mysql代理服务器?

    用java8基于vert.x3 快速实现一个最简单的mysql代理服务器,只需要5分钟时间. 什么是mysql 代理? mysql代理是介于client端和mysql服务端中间层服务,如下图所示: 这 ...

  2. Eclipse : java连接数据库MySQL超详细步骤

    Eclipse:java连接数据库MySQL 首先我们需要下载连接数据库所需要的桥JDBC.然后将其导入到项目中,其次编写连接数据库类. 下载MySQL JDBC 打开MySQL JDBC下载地址,然 ...

  3. java 银行管理系统(连接数据库Mysql)

    java 银行管理系统(连接数据库Mysql) 逻辑与功能图 实现逻辑 功能图 代码 逻辑与功能图 实现逻辑 程序共有三个文件 Bankmangement.java:包括程序运行的主函数,方法等 Us ...

  4. java mysql_Java与mysql的连接

    接触编程.计算机一段时间,免不了的就要接触到,各种数据,而各种数据到了深处自然就要接触到数据的存储和调用,之前在我的文章中,已经了解到了IO流在文件中以及在TCP\IP协议中的各种传输,而慢慢的,随着 ...

  5. web mysql数据库的持久连接_JavaWeb连接数据库MySQL的操作技巧

    数据库是编程中重要的一部分,它囊括了数据操作,数据持久化等各方面.在每一门编程语言中都占有相当大的比例. 本次,我以MySQL为例,使用MVC编程思想(请参阅我之前的博客).简单演示一下JavaWeb ...

  6. Android端+java后端+servlet+MySQL的型男塑造平台【前后端源代码+论文+答辩ppt】

    活动地址:毕业季·进击的技术er 目录 前言 第一章 绪论 1.1 背景和意义 1.2 国内外研究现状 1.3 论文研究目标与内容 1.4.减肥瘦身相关概念与计算方式介绍 第二章 需求分析 2.1 平 ...

  7. Java EE系列(九)——Java EE连接Mysql数据库(JDBC保姆级教学)

    最近几天,peter xiao所在的项目小组也逐渐开始进行做最后的Java web课程大作业了,我们组所做的是运动会报名服务系统,其中涉及到很多数据的增删查改,所以需要依靠Mysql数据库来解决这些问 ...

  8. JAVA数据库:MySQL入门

    前言 MySQL数据库是目前Web开发最流行的数据库,本章将介绍数据库的有关概念,并且讲解如何安装和配置MySQL. MySQL的概述 MySQL是一个关系型数据库管理系统,由瑞典MySQL AB 公 ...

  9. Java jdbc连接数据库 INSERT插入

    Java jdbc连接数据库 INSERT插入 package com.edu; import java.sql.Connection; import java.sql.DriverManager; ...

最新文章

  1. 针对web服务器容灾自动切换方案
  2. 视频台词现在不用背也不用配,连对口型都免了
  3. Linuxnbsp;JDK1.4卸载与1.6的安装
  4. 选择UPS电源的四大要素
  5. java filter函数的用法_5分钟掌握Python | Map、Reduce和Filter如何运用?
  6. Web API系列(三)统一异常处理
  7. 尼康G镜头与D镜头的差别
  8. docker容器mysql头文件_在Docker容器中使用MySQL数据库
  9. vue 中provide的用法_浅谈vue中provide和inject 用法
  10. 计算机应用基础 项目4-5 分析商品销售业绩 ppt课件,计算机应用基础课件项目四汇总.ppt...
  11. 个人对于封装继承多态的理解
  12. c语言调用abs需要加什么作用,c语言中abs函数怎么用
  13. 【转】深入理解Instrument
  14. Spring Cloud限流详解
  15. 基于信心上界蒙特卡洛搜索树(UCT)实现四子棋
  16. 占星术杀人魔法 - 笔记
  17. Java实现蓝桥杯VIP 算法训练 sign函数
  18. pytorch根据开放场景语音文字合成新语音(VoiceLoop)
  19. 如果今天是生命里的最后一天你想做点啥
  20. OriginPro,如何把软件Origin切换变成中文显示

热门文章

  1. LaTeX 中少量俄文的输入
  2. java字母正则表达式,带有国际字母的Java正则表达式
  3. 移动 网络 连mysql_中国移动MySQL数据库优化最佳实践
  4. x86汇编_短路求值-AND / OR运算符_笔记_39
  5. Linux Ext2文件系统
  6. UNIX时间戳与日期的相互转换
  7. 题目名称:组个最小数时间限制:1000ms内存限制:256MB提交通过率:43%
  8. 基于HTTP的简单网络爬虫
  9. Python爬虫获取股票信息代码分享
  10. 负荷分配问题的动态规划算法递归实现